iommu/arm-smmu-v3: Parse PASID devicetree property of platform devices
For platform devices that support SubstreamID (SSID), firmware provides the number of supported SSID bits. Restrict it to what the SMMU supports and cache it into master->ssid_bits, which will also be used for PCI PASID.
